General News: Cornwall Independence Day Committee News
from the Cornwall Independence Day Committee
June 5, 2016
Keep the flame alive for future generations as Cornwall now tells tales of Cornwall then, in our historic living history pageant--"Courage in Cornwall: Highlights from Our Heritage" --filled with inspiring scenes of Drama! Romance! Adventure! Tragedy and comedy! Showcasing local talent of all kinds among all age groups!
Inspired by Lin-Manuel Miranda's Broadway hit show, "Hamilton," Cornwall's unique Fourth of July historic pageant tradition (performed each year at 6:30 pm, right after the parade) is being updated to be "Cornwall then, told by Cornwall now." Volunteers of all ages are needed, onstage and off, to help with this amazing transformation--actors, singers, dancers, musicians, assistant directors, choreographers, publicists, production assistants, stage crew, etc.--even if you can only give a few minutes or a few hours. Help tell our story of colonial and revolutionary years, Cornwall’s founding, colonial life, and our region’s contributions to the American Revolution for Independence and Liberty, re-enacting what happened in and around Cornwall to give us a nation, and a reason to celebrate the Fourth of July.
